    8PedroReviews

    Loki: "For all time. Always."

    Marvel's Loki is a captivating and thought-provoking television series that delves into the complex and intriguing character of Loki, the God of Mischief. The show masterfully explores themes of identity, free will, and the nature of reality, while expanding the ever-growing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) in unexpected and exciting ways.

    Tom Hiddleston delivers a compelling performance as Loki, capturing the character's mischievous charm, cunning intellect, and underlying vulnerability with a convincing blend of humor and depth. The supporting cast is equally impressive, with Owen Wilson as the charming and unpredictable Mobius M. Mobius, Gugu Mbatha-Raw as the enigmatic Ravonna Renslayer, and Sophia Di Martino as the mysterious Sylvie, providing Loki with intriguing companions and adversaries throughout his journey.

    Loki's story takes him on a mind-bending journey through the vast expanse of the Time Variance Authority (TVA), a bureaucratic organization tasked with maintaining the sacred timeline of the multiverse. As Loki grapples with his past actions and attempts to escape the TVA's clutches, he encounters a vast array of alternate versions of himself, each with their own unique perspectives and motivations.

    The show's exploration of time travel and the multiverse is both entertaining and engaging. It raises intriguing questions about the nature of reality, the consequences of altering the past, and the possibility of multiple universes existing simultaneously. Loki's journey through these concepts adds a new layer of complexity to the MCU's mythology, while providing ample opportunities for thrilling action sequences and thought-provoking philosophical musings.

    Personally, Season 1 of Loki is stronger than Season 2, but both seasons offer engaging narratives and captivating character development. Season 1 excels in its exploration of Loki's complex psychology and his journey of self-discovery, while Season 2 delves deeper into the mysteries of the multiverse and introduces new and intriguing elements to the MCU.

    Loki is a worthwhile watch for fans of the MCU and science fiction. While it doesn't quite reach the heights of the very best Marvel shows, it offers a captivating and thought-provoking adventure that will keep you entertained and engaged.
    10tmachaya

    Loki is a must watch.

    Loki: A Masterful Exploration of Time, Identity, and the Marvel Universe Marvel Studios has once again delivered a groundbreaking series with "Loki," a mind-bending exploration of time, identity, and the complexities of the God of Mischief himself. This series not only expands the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) but also delves into thought-provoking concepts that leave viewers questioning the very fabric of reality.

    Tom Hiddleston reprises his iconic role as Loki, delivering a performance that is both captivating and nuanced. His portrayal of the character is layered and multifaceted, showcasing Loki's evolution from a cunning villain to a conflicted anti-hero. Hiddleston's chemistry with Owen Wilson, who plays the TVA agent Mobius M. Mobius, is electric, generating witty banter and genuine camaraderie.

    The series' exploration of the multiverse and the Time Variance Authority (TVA) is both ambitious and executed with precision. The TVA, a bureaucratic organization tasked with maintaining the "Sacred Timeline," introduces a fascinating new element to the MCU. The series masterfully blends sci-fi concepts with philosophical questions about free will, destiny, and the nature of existence.

    One of the standout aspects of "Loki" is its ability to balance humor and heart. The series is filled with witty dialogue and comedic moments that lighten the tone, while also delving into deeper themes of identity and belonging. Loki's journey of self-discovery is both poignant and relatable, as he grapples with his past actions and seeks to forge a new path for himself.

    The series' visual effects are stunning, creating a visually captivating world that is both familiar and otherworldly. The production design is meticulous, bringing the TVA and otherworldly locations to life with stunning detail. The score, composed by Natalie Holt, is both haunting and exhilarating, perfectly complementing the series' tone and atmosphere.

    "Loki" is a must-watch for any Marvel fan, but it also appeals to a broader audience with its intelligent storytelling and thought-provoking themes. It is a series that will stay with you long after the credits roll, leaving you pondering the mysteries of time and the possibilities of the multiverse.

    In conclusion, "Loki" is a triumph of storytelling, acting, and visual effects. It is a series that pushes the boundaries of the MCU and offers a fresh perspective on one of its most beloved characters. With its compelling narrative, stellar performances, and stunning visuals, "Loki" is a must-watch for any fan of science fiction, fantasy, and superhero entertainment.
    9Supermanfan-13

    Great addition to the MCU

    Loki was even better than I thought it would be and is easily one of the best Marvel series to date. Loki plays a huge part in this newest phase of the MCU, everything from the new Deadpool & Wolverine movie to the newest Ant-Man is tied into Loki. That's because Loki introduces us to the TVA (The Time Variance Authority). Besides Thanos, Loki is easily the next best villain turned antihero in the MCU. His evolution and character arc from a villain to antihero is done perfectly. As good as the writing is for this show it's Tom Hiddleston's performance as Loki that makes this the best of the Disney Marvel shows. What more can be said about Hiddleston that hasn't already been said? He's such an underrated actor and his best work has come as Loki. This also has fantastic performances from a great cast that includes Owen Wilson, Jonathan Majors, Ke Huy Quan, Sophia Di Martino, among others. I really can not recommend this incredible series enough.

    • Trivia
      Rather than read Marvel comics to prepare for the role of Agent Mobius, Owen Wilson instead had Tom Hiddleston explain the entire Marvel Cinematic Universe to him.
    • Quotes

      Loki: You're taking me somewhere to kill me?

      Mobius: No, I'm taking you some place to talk.

      Loki: Well, I don't like to talk.

      Mobius: But you do like to lie. Which you just did, 'cause we both know you love to talk.

    • Crazy credits
      The Marvel Studios logo turns green and gold, Loki's colors.
